Modern drones, thermal sensors, and machine-vision systems do not just search for heat. They look for contrast, outline, repetition, and signatures that do not belong.

Thermoflage is designed to break up those cues so covered garments, shelters, equipment, and vehicle surfaces read less like a clean target and more like background clutter.

Why Passive Matters

Thermoflage uses a passive approach to reduce dependence on power, charging, and active thermal management in field conditions.

No Power Dependency

No charging schedule, cables, powered cooling loop, or active electronics requirement.

Lower Support Burden

Fewer components mean fewer failure points and less setup complexity in the field.

Built For Sensor-Rich Environments

The design focus is on disrupting obvious thermal presentation, not simply masking heat with a flat surface.

Adaptable Coverage

One product category can be configured across personnel, shelter, equipment, and vehicle use cases.
